Output 342cfc3eda2452c502266f3051644ef7884022b320456613ad463e6fdee580f6:1

value
952161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 168acd773a40f7a0b21049a7d18a546c4108e83f OP_EQUAL
address
33kD4wLwwLMGRCcSC21jDsgdPCCHawRBbP
transaction
342cfc3eda2452c502266f3051644ef7884022b320456613ad463e6fdee580f6
spent
true